7 Everyday Habits That Help Keep Your Dog Healthy and Happy

Make Daily Walks a Priority

Exercise is essential for your pup’s physical and mental health. Daily walks help manage his weight, support joint health, and provide crucial mental stimulation from all the exciting sights and smells in the neighborhood. Offer a Consistent Feeding Routine

Consistency is key when it comes to your dog’s diet. Feeding your pooch at the same times each day helps regulate his digestion, prevent overeating, and allows your veterinarian to track any changes in appetite. Be sure to use a high-quality dog food that matches his breed, age, and energy level. If you’re unsure, our animal hospital can help you find the right fit.

Brush Those Teeth!

Dental health is often overlooked, but it’s one of the most important aspects of dog care. Regular brushing at home can prevent gum disease and costly dental procedures. Ideally, brush your pup’s teeth several times a week, and ask our vets about dog-safe toothpaste and treats that support oral hygiene.

Keep Him Mentally Stimulated

Your furry pal needs more than just physical exercise—his brain needs stimulation, too! Puzzle toys, treat-dispensing balls, and even basic obedience training can help keep his mind sharp. This is one of the best ways to reduce boredom-based behavior issues, like chewing or excessive barking.

Maintain Regular Grooming

Whether he’s a shaggy sheepdog or a short-haired Lab, your dog needs regular grooming. Brushing helps remove loose fur, prevents matting, and gives you the chance to check for any skin issues. Many pet parents bring their pups to our veterinary clinic for nail trims and coat care advice.

Schedule Routine Wellness Exams

Annual or biannual checkups at your local vet clinic are vital. These visits allow your veterinarian to catch issues early—before they become serious. 

Shower Him with Love and Attention

While it might seem obvious, showing your pup love every day is critical to his emotional well-being. A happy, relaxed dog is a healthy one! Spend quality time with your canine companion, whether it’s cuddling on the couch or heading to your favorite park. Remember: the bond between you and your four-legged friend plays a huge role in his overall wellness.

FAQs About Keeping Your Dog Healthy

How often should I walk my dog?

Most dogs benefit from at least 30 minutes to an hour of exercise each day, though active breeds may need more. Ask our veterinarians about the best routine for your specific pooch.

Do I really need to brush my dog’s teeth?

Yes! Dental health affects your dog’s overall wellness. Brushing a few times a week, along with dental chews, can help prevent plaque buildup and reduce the risk of oral disease.

What should I feed my dog?

The ideal diet depends on your dog’s age, breed, size, and activity level. Our vets in Lake Echo, NS can recommend veterinarian-approved diets that meet your furry buddy’s needs.
